Listen "ALK rearranged renal cell carcinoma (ALK-RCC)"
Episode Synopsis
The host discusses with Professor Ondrej Hes, from the Charles University in the Czech Republic, his recent multi-institutional study that further defines ALK-RCC as a genetically distinct renal cancer type showing a heterogeneous histomorphology. The authors advocate a routine ALK IHC screening for “unclassifiable RCCs” with heterogeneous features.
